Group 1 - The first International Low Altitude Economy Expo recently opened in Shanghai, featuring nearly 300 leading companies and showcasing 19 global and 25 national product launches [1] - A significant procurement agreement was signed between Volant Aviation and Thailand's Pan Pacific Company for 500 eVTOL aircraft, amounting to $1.75 billion, marking the largest international order for high-grade passenger eVTOLs in China to date [1] - The general aviation sector is expected to accelerate from concept to reality, supported by policy, technology, and market dynamics, with the upcoming Guangda National Index General Aviation Fund anticipated to be an effective investment tool for investors [1] Group 2 - The low altitude economy has been included in government work reports for two consecutive years, with a clear roadmap established by the Ministry of Industry and Information Technology to achieve a trillion-level market by 2030 [2] - Over 25 provinces and cities have incorporated low altitude economy initiatives into their government reports, with more than 24 low altitude economy industry funds established [2] - The low altitude economy in China reached 505.95 billion yuan by the end of 2023, with projections to exceed one trillion yuan by 2026 and 3.5 trillion yuan by 2035 [2] Group 3 - The development trajectory of the general aviation industry is highly similar to that of the new energy vehicle industry a decade ago, with both being included in the strategic emerging industries category [4] - eVTOL technology shares about 70% of its core components with new energy vehicle technology, indicating a strong technological overlap [4] Group 4 - The National General Aviation Industry Index has shown an average increase of 560.96% since its inception, highlighting the high growth potential of the sector [5][7] - The index consists of 50 securities related to materials, infrastructure, aircraft manufacturing, and operational services within the general aviation industry [5] Group 5 - The top ten constituents of the National General Aviation Index are predominantly large companies with high technological barriers, indicating strong growth potential [7] - The index's constituents have an aggregate weight of 52.87% in low altitude economy-related enterprises, closely tied to this technological wave [9] Group 6 - The low altitude economy is transitioning from conceptual exploration to large-scale application, with various industries benefiting from its implementation [10] - By 2027, urban low altitude logistics is expected to operate on a large scale, with "air taxis" potentially becoming a new commuting option by 2030 [10] - The use of drones in agriculture has significantly increased efficiency, allowing for extensive monitoring and application of agricultural practices [10] Group 7 - The integration of general aviation into transportation logistics, major engineering, and public services is expected to release substantial economic value and social benefits [11] - The Guangda National Index General Aviation Fund aims to help investors capitalize on the investment opportunities arising from the development of the low altitude economy [11]
